What is a Long-Neck Sander?
A long-neck sander, also understood as an extended reach sander, is a tool designed for sanding big surfaces-- particularly ceilings or tall walls-- that would otherwise be hard to reach with standard sanders. The design typically includes a long manage connected to a sanding head, allowing users to accomplish a smooth finish without the requirement for scaffolding or Akku Schlagschrauber Vergleich ladders.

What kinds of surface areas can a long-neck sander be utilized on?
Long-neck sanders are ideal for drywall, plaster, wood, and some concrete surfaces. Each surface area may need specific sanding pads or strategies.
2. How do I know which grit sandpaper to utilize?
Selecting the right grit includes starting with a coarser grit for heavy material removal, then moving towards finer grits for raveling the surface area.
3. Is a long-neck sander essential for small tasks?
While useful for large areas, for small tasks or information, a manual sander may be enough. Nevertheless, using a long-neck sander normally supplies a more uniform finish.
4. Exist any security issues connected with utilizing a long-neck sander?
Yes, it is essential to wear security goggles and a dust mask to avoid inhaling dust and prevent eye inflammation. Furthermore, guarantee proper body posture to avoid pressure.
5. How regularly should the sandpaper be altered?
The frequency of sandpaper replacement varies depending upon the product being dealt with and the depth of sanding. Generally, once the sandpaper appears clogged up or ineffective, it must be altered.
